Israel launches $11 million tourism advertising campaign
Israel has launched $11 million advertising campaign in North America, designed to boost tourism to Israel from the United States and Canada. The campaign, to be executing through December 2007 by Israel`s Ministry of Tourism, will be spread over a variety of media types, including network television, cable TV, national magazines, newspaper travel sections, professional and religious media, billboards and New York City bus shelters.
Print advertisements include depictions of a dancer on the beach in Tel Aviv, a chef in Jerusalem, a cowboy on the Golan Heights, a Tel Aviv high-tech expert whose hobby is building guitars, and an archeologist atop Masada. The television campaign will be concentrated in New York, Los Angeles and south Florida.
Travelers from North America representing the largest single source of tourism to the country, with some 600,000 North Americans visited Israel in 2006, almost 30% of the total tourists visiting Israel last year. Israel goal is to double North American tourism to Israel by 2010.

Tourism to Israel drop by 4.5% to 1.83 million tourists in 2006
The number of tourists entered Israel in 2006 decreased by 4.5% to 1.83 million, from 1.91 million tourists in 2005, according to the Israeli Central Bureau of Statistics.
The first six months of 2006 showed an increase of 22% to over 1 million tourists, compare to the same period in 2005. But the outbreak of the Lebanon war in July 2006 leads to a drop of 27% in July-December to 0.76 million tourists that entered Israel.
The United States was the largest source of visitors to Israel. 494,000 tourists arrived from US in 2006, 8% more than a year earlier. 161,000 arrived from the UK, 3% more than in 2005.

E&Y: Israeli tourism industry can grow to 4-5 million tourist arrivals by 2011
Israel can achieve 4-5 million tourist arrivals by 2011 if it would focus on improving long-term marketing, infrastructure, attracting investors and adopting a more liberal aviation policy, according to a report by international consulting firm Ernst & Young (E&Y).
The study about the Israeli tourism industry points out that investing $50 million a year on marketing Israel as an attractive travel destination will produce a $447 million a year in new revenues from foreign tourist arrivals. This would also be a major catalyst of growth for Israel economy, by boosting the GDP by $3.5 billion and creating 45,000 new jobs in Israel.
According to the Ernst & Young's optimistic estimates, Israel has a potential to bring 18 million tourists from eight major markets: the US, UK, Germany, France, Italy and Sweden, and then on Russia and China. Currently, only 1.2 million visitors come to Israel from those countries every year.

More than million foreigners visited Israel in the first 7 months of 2005
A total of 1,063,917 foreigners visited Israel in the first seven months of the year, a 29 per cent rise over the same period in 2004, according to figures released by the Central Bureau of Statistics and Israel's Ministry of Tourism.
268,601 U.S. tourists arrived in Israel in the first seven months of the year, a 25 per cent increase over the same period last year, and a record 174,600 French tourists arrived between January and July 2005, a 27 per cent hike.
"Our goal is to welcome five million tourists to the country by the end of 2008," said Israel's Minister of Tourism Avraham Hirchson in response to the figures.
